Instructions
-
Start by pressing the block of tofu to remove excess water. Once drained, slice the tofu into 1/2-inch thick pieces.
-
In a shallow dish, mix together the soy sauce, sesame oil, minced garlic, salt, and pepper. Marinate the tofu slices in this mixture for at least 30 minutes.
-
While the tofu is marinating, prepare the pickled vegetables. In a bowl, mix the julienned carrot and daikon with rice vinegar, sugar, and salt. Let it sit for at least 20 minutes to allow the flavors to meld together.
-
In a small b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ise, Sriracha sauce, and lime juice to create the spicy Sriracha sauce.
-
Heat a pan over medium-high heat and cook the marinated tofu slices for about 3-4 minutes on each side, or until they are golden brown and slightly crispy.
-
To assemble the banh mi, spread a generous amount of Sriracha sauce on both halves of the baguette. Layer on the cooked tofu slices, pickled vegetables, cilantro leaves, cucumber slices, jalapenos, and red onion.
-
Close the sandwich and press gently to ensure the filling stays in place. Slice the banh mi into individual portions, and serve immediately.
